I added a post today and it was inserted second in all the blog posts that up to today were posted in descending post date order. How did that happen?

Hello there,
Will you please post an active link starting with http:// to the blog post in question so we can examine it and help you?This can happen when one first begins to blog and they fail to set up their own local timezone on this page > Settings > General The default setting is UTC time until we personalize it. Note that adjusting the timezone there is not retroactive. That means one has to edit posts following the change and correct the timestamps in the Publish module and then click “update”.
Another cause can be setting the post as a sticky post. By removing the “sticky” designation in the Publish module and clicking “update” that can be corrected as well. http://en.support.wordpress.com/posts/post-visibility/#sticky-posts

where is my publish module
On every post and page we create in the far right hand column we find the big blue “publish” (update) button. It’s in the Publish module. http://en.support.wordpress.com/screen-options/
